The Significance of RTP and Volatility in Modern Slot Design
Understanding RTP and volatility is foundational to evaluating the risk and reward profile of a slot game. RTP, expressed as a percentage, indicates the theoretical return a player can expect over a prolonged period, serving as an essential benchmark for transparency and fairness. Conversely, volatility measures the variance in payouts—whether a game tends to reward players with frequent small wins or rare, substantial jackpots.
For instance, a game with a high RTP (e.g., 98%) and low volatility provides players with consistent, modest gains, ideal for conservative bettors. On the other hand, high volatility titles might feature larger jackpots but infrequent payouts. Striking the right balance between these factors is vital in catering to diverse player preferences.

The Technical Underpinnings of Modern Slot Metrics
Calculating accurate RTP and volatility requires a sophisticated understanding of game mechanics, reels, paylines, and the underlying randomness algorithms (RNG). Advanced mathematical modelling during game development ensures that the designed payout structure aligns with the declared metrics, fostering player trust.
For example, a game with medium volatility might incorporate features such as randomly triggered bonus rounds, scatter symbols, and multipliers, deliberately engineered to maintain the RTP within a narrow target range—say, 96.00% to 97.00%.
